The levy imposed on actual property situated inside Charlotte, North Carolina, is set by multiplying the assessed worth of a property by the mixed charges established by Mecklenburg County, the Metropolis of Charlotte, and relevant particular tax districts. For instance, a property assessed at $300,000 with a mixed price of 1.2% would incur an annual tax of $3,600.
This income stream is important for funding very important public companies, together with training, public security, infrastructure upkeep, and parks and recreation.
